Seven Sunday Senryu
the cardinals nest
in a leafless white birch tree
…awaiting sunrise
wandering cow paths
a cobblestone history
…fog on the water
A sleepy sunrise
slow dances with the dust motes
…an unopened book
an old barking dog
hears not its distant echo
…chasing memories
billowing beauty
seen through the eyes of children
…passing clouds perform
domesticated
a window cat licks itself
…predatory death
An ancient Elm knows
Time scars all that it touches
…with its gnarly grasp
John G. Lawless
